Air Conditioning: The Old Vic Theatre is air conditioned.
Food & Drink: Light snacks and drinks in plastic containers are allowed in the auditorium. Drinks purchased from the bar must be transferred into plastic cups if they are being taken inside the auditorium. Hot food is prohibited in the theatre.
Cloakroom
There is a cloakroom in which large bags and pushchairs can be checked.
Children
Unfortunately the Old Vic Theatre does not provide booster cushions.
Bar
There are three bars; one on each level as well as The ‘Pit Bar’, which is located below the Old Vic Theatre and is open until midnight. Prices:

Toilets
Male and female toilets are accessible from all levels and the disabled access adapted toilets are situated in the stalls.
